Marvel Rivals Dev Faces Social Media Pressure, Announces Major Season 3 Changes
NetEase Games is making significant changes to the Marvel Rivals post-launch roadmap to keep the game's momentum strong. They plan to shorten the seasons and introduce at least one new hero every month. This update was hinted at in the new Marvel Rivals Season 2 Dev Vision Vol. 5 video. The video, lasting 15 minutes, revealed that Season 2, launching on April 11, will introduce Emma Frost as a new Vanguard and Ultron mid-season, though his class will be disclosed later. These new characters are set to bring fresh abilities to the game, with even more significant changes slated for Season 3.
Starting with Season 3, which doesn't have a set release date yet, NetEase will reduce season lengths from three months to two. This means major content updates will come faster, but the promise of at least one new hero every half-season will remain intact. After Emma Frost's launch next week, players will wait just a month and a half for Ultron, with subsequent hero releases coming even quicker.
In the Dev Vision video, Marvel Rivals creative director Guangyun Chen discussed the team's commitment to delivering a fun and engaging experience. "Since the launch of Season 1, we’ve been deeply contemplating how Marvel Rivals can continuously deliver fun and engaging experience for you all," Chen said. He acknowledged the pressure from social media discussions and the team's desire to keep the game exciting, as it was at launch in December. Chen emphasized that NetEase aims to fulfill players' fantasies about Marvel Super Heroes by exploring new modes and introducing a diverse roster of characters. After "extensive internal discussions and thorough evaluations," NetEase will adjust its systems to handle the increased content flow, with more details to be shared before Season 3 launches.
"With our goal of keeping the audience’s excitement alive just like our opening months, the real adventure with Marvel Rivals is just beginning," Chen added.
Just hours ago, NetEase pulled back the curtain on Marvel Rivals Season 2, announcing a shift from the vampire takeover theme to a new storyline centered around the Hellfire Gala. This change will bring new outfits, maps, and characters, with more details to be revealed in the coming weeks.
Since its launch in December, Marvel Rivals has been a massive success, attracting 10 million players in just three days. The game, a free-to-play superhero team-based PvP shooter, was released on December 6 across PC via Steam and the Epic Games Store, PlayStation 5, and Xbox Series X and S. On Steam, it saw an impressive 480,990 concurrent players at launch, and Season 1 in January peaked at 644,269 concurrent players, making it the 15th most-played game on Valve's platform. However, player numbers have been declining, which might have prompted NetEase's roadmap changes. Despite this, Marvel Rivals remains highly popular and is among Steam's most-played games. The launch of Season 2 and the anticipated Season 3 are expected to boost player engagement further.
